Pension
New employees are automatically enrolled into the College’s pension scheme. After six months, the College contributes to a defined contribution pension scheme (currently the Group Pension Plan), matching your employee contribution on a 2:1 basis up to a maximum of 14% employer contribution. The rate at which employees contribute to the GPP starts at 5%, but you can choose how much you wish to contribute, up to tax limits for pension contributions.
Annual leave
The standard leave entitlement is 25.5 days (pro-rata for part-time staff) plus 8 public holidays. Employees are granted additional days’ annual leave in recognition of length of service, to a maximum of 30.5 days plus public holidays.
Health
The College offers a health care cash plan to employees after 6 months’ service. Run by Simplyhealth, membership of the plan allows you to claim back money on the cost of everyday health care, such as dental treatment, eye tests, physiotherapy, consultations etc. The service also provides telephone consultations with a doctor, access to an advice and counselling helpline, and online information on health.
The cost of basic level membership is met in full by the College. You can choose to upgrade your level of cover, or include a partner on the scheme, at your own expense.
Wellbeing
Staff can access counselling through our College support team. Simply email [email protected] stating that you are a member of staff who would like access to counselling. (Please don’t give any further details at this point – a member of the counselling team will reply to your email to make contact and you can then discuss your issues in confidence.)
Simplyhealth membership also provides access to a counsellor by phone and to a GP advice line 24/7 365 days a year. Simplyhealth membership is covered by the College: speak to HR if you are not already a member and would like to join.
All members of staff have access to the College Library. The Library’s Wellbeing Collection has over 150 books and ebooks which have been curated by the library team with assistance from the College Nurse and College Counsellor. The collection covers a range of topics including bereavement, depression, anxiety and self-esteem.
Food
Staff working on-site can have one free meal during the normal working day. This may be taken as breakfast, lunch or dinner and should be taken during your rest break. Staff are entitled to a meal during their working hours, so if you leave work before 12 noon, then you are eligible for breakfast or buttery options.
Staff must present either your College fob or University card at the till to obtain your free meal.
- Dining Hall – Two course meal (no canned or bottled drinks) plus dessert.
- E.g. starter (soup/salad) and one main course item plus vegetables of your choice. Your dessert may be taken with your meal or from the Buttery during the day.
or
- Buttery – Sandwich/Sushi, one further item (e.g. crisps) plus dessert (no drinks); or Pizza and dessert.
(There may be some occasions where the Dining Hall is out of use for staff but this will be communicated in advance, and extra food laid on in the Buttery). We aim to cater for all dietary requirements.
Gym and sport
Staff can use the College’s sports facilities, including the gym, squash courts and tennis courts.
You are required to have an induction before using the College gym.
Cyclescheme
Churchill College is part of this scheme, which can save you 25-39% on a bike and accessories. Payments are taken tax efficiently from your salary.
Techscheme
Spread the cost of an item of new technology with payments from your salary across 12, 24 or 36 months and make a National Insurance saving.
